The Best Poem Of MAXINE P. SOSO

For One Night

I wanted you last night
not only to make love
but, to bask in the ambience
of your presence
to hold you and, mold you
to my bodies specifications
So, I stared at your picture
though you weren't there
my body started to tremble
as though you were here
It seemed you were coming
right out of the frame
my mind keep on playing
these tricks and, these games
I smell your cologne
it's all in the air
you're voice keep on ringing
inside of my ears
I stare at your picture
when you're not here
my mind seems to wander
anytime, anywhere
Though I can't see your face
it's embedded in my mind
I see it everyday
everywhere, all the time
I wanted you last night
for only one night
to make love to my heart
my soul and, my mind.
